HOUSTON - In a major development for the Greater Houston economy, Fortune 100 drugmaker Eli Lilly has announced plans for a $6.5 billion manufacturing facility at Generation Park in Northeast Harris County.
Lilly to build $6.5B Houston facility
What they're saying:
"Texas offered speed and scale from blueprint to validation to production of medicines. This region offers top-notch talent rooted in its history in the energy, aerospace and medical industries," said Dave Ricks, Eli Lilly CEO.
Ricks said the Houston area beat out 300 competing proposals from 40 different states, all vying to be players in "reshoring" America's pharmaceutical making capacity.
